【CakePHP TwigView插件缺少视图错误】教程文章相关的互联网学习教程文章

Cakephp:在插入tinyint字段时.仅获取“ 0”或“ 1”【代码】

我是Cakephp的菜鸟.在一个开源项目上工作.问题是: 当我为某个表插入一个值(“ is_adjusted”(tinyint))时,我的php代码成功执行.但是该表仅使用0或1作为其值.样例代码:$reward = $ta_customer_reward->newEntity();$string_reward = var_export($reward, true);$reward->customer_email = $some_preset_xyz;$reward->reward_amount = $some_preset_xyz;;$reward->particulars = $some_preset_xyz;.. .. .. // This is_adjusted is...

CakePHP增量值【代码】

我的问题如下所示: 我想制作一个投票应用程序,以便人们可以选择一个或多个事件(例如Doodle).为此,我设置了一个称为表决的功能.在视图中,您可以选择事件使用复选框.模型是民意调查和小组活动.投票有许多Groupevent.我的问题是,当我调用updateAll()时,关联的Groupevents的所有值都是递增. 这是我的代码: 视图:echo $this->Form->create('Poll', array('action' => 'vote'));for($i=0; $i<$count; $i++){echo $this->Form->input('...

javascript-CakePHP项目中的Jquery Ajax请求禁止返回(403)【代码】

编辑2 我仍然需要帮助,因为错误仍未解决.下面,我添加了指向.ajaxError()抛出的屏幕截图的链接: http://i.imgur.com/RkcgNtG.jpg 另一个想法是服务器设置. suphp或mpm_itk模块是否有可能是导致此错误的原因? 编辑 我已经弄明白了.我的Ajax-Call应该从输入和文本区域更新一些数据.我进行了更多测试,发现403仅在我的文本区域的值或输入的值具有多个空格的情况下才会出现.因此“ that-is-a-test”和“ thatisatest”可以正常工作,但“...

SaveMany用于在cakePHP中同时更新多个记录不起作用【代码】

我在使用saveMany同时更新多个记录时遇到问题,我的关联如下: >候选人有很多候选人雇主>候选人雇主属于候选人 Candidate.php中的模型关联:public $hasMany = array('CandidatesEmployer' => array('className' => 'CandidatesEmployer','foreignKey' => 'candidate_id') }这是CandidatesController中的方法:public function jbseeker_empdetails() {$this->layout = 'front_common';$Employers = $this->Candidate->CandidatesEm...

使用虚拟字段求和cakephp中的值【代码】

我正在尝试获取给定用户的投票总数. 说这是职位表id | body | user_id | vote_total | type 1 test 1 4 new 2 test2 1 3 new 3 test3 2 2 new我正在尝试获得以下输出user_id | vote_total1 72 2这是我在PostsController中的函数public function topvotes(){ $virtualFields = array('total' => 'SUM(Post.vote_total)');$total = $...

Cakephp生成xml错误-空白【代码】

我试图在CakePHP中生成一个动态xml文档以输出到浏览器. 这是我的控制器代码:Configure::write ('debug', 0); $this->layout = null; header('Content-type: text/xml'); echo "<?xml version=\"1.0\"?>";视图是这样的:<abc>something </abc>输出可能与预期的一样:<?xml version="1.0"?><abc>something</abc>唯一的问题是<?xml之前有一个空格,给我一个错误: XML Parsing Error: XML or text declaration not at start of entit...

在cakephp中使用回调方法解密和加密【代码】

我想使用Callbacks方法在将值存储在数据库中之前对其进行加密,并在将其显示回应用程序之前对其进行解密. 我使用了documentation中提供的示例之一. 在我的core.php中,放入以下内容:Configure::write('Security.cipherCriptKey','su0HKssPmdbwgK6LdQLqzp0YmyaTI7zO');在我的模型中,我使用了两种方法: > beforeSave()public function beforeSave($options = array()) {$value=$this->data['Internship']['encryptedindb'];$encrypte...

CakePHP HTML Helper:链接中的图像被转义了吗?【代码】

从Cake 1.2更新到1.3,我有一个嵌套在link元素中的图像,它们都由HTML助手生成.但是,嵌套图像的标记会从<到& gt;等.我知道默认情况下HTML帮助程序现在会转义内容,但是我无法更改它.这是生成示例图像链接的代码: $html->link($html->image('icons/small/navigation-back.gif', array('alt'=>"Move Left", 'border'=>"0")) ,'#',array('id'=>'options_left'), array('escape'=>false))我从官方Cake文档($options数组的一部分)中添加了...

CakePHP中的可变前缀路由【代码】

我正在CakePHP中创建一个应用程序,这需要我在一个CakePHP安装中运行“多个”应用程序.像我有n个控制器,它们对所有应用程序的行为都一样,但是它们仅在我调用数据库时有所不同-无论如何,我需要创建一个行为如下的路由:/app1/controller/action/a/b/c /app2/controller/action/a/b/c (其中app1和app2是可以更改为任何内容的字母数字字符串) 那将被路由到类似: /controller/action/app1/a/b/c (或与app2相同,依此类推) 路由的路由也...

CakePHP Security :: cipher()不适用于服务器【代码】

我在阅读加密的cookie时遇到问题.调试显示,服务器上的Security :: cipher()某种程度上已损坏.反正有什么我可以解决的吗? 以下是细分. 码$value = "Hello World"; $key = Configure::read('Security.salt');$val = Security::cipher($value, $key); debug($val); $ret = Security::cipher($val, $key); debug($ret);本地app\views\pages\home.ctp (line 17) ?J??WtJ0?app\views\pages\home.ctp (line 19) Hello World服务器app/vie...

CakePHP订单无法正常工作【代码】

嗨,我正在使用CakePHP版本-2.5.5. 我有一个表名称chat_ategory_mages,我想通过降序获得平均频率顺序数.知道频率请检查-How to get Average hits between current date to posted date in MySQL? chat_ategory_magesid chat_category_id hits created ------------------------------------------------ 1 5 10 2014-11-07 11:07:57 2 5 8 2014-11...

CakePHP TwigView插件缺少视图错误【代码】

我主要使用CakePHP 2.4.2和this插件. 我想将TwigView与CakePHP一起使用,发现上面的插件与CakePHP 2.0兼容.遵循所有安装步骤,但是在执行脚本时出现Missing View错误. 我的AppController.php<?phpApp::uses('Controller', 'Controller');class AppController extends Controller {public $viewClass = 'TwigView.Twig';}视图的范围是.tpl,但是,即使添加了插件,它仍在寻找.ctp范围. 我还使用以下命令在bootstrap.php中加载了插件CakeP...

使用或不使用密码更新用户-CakePHP【代码】

我尝试在CakePHP v.2.7中找到一种好方法来处理管理面板“编辑用户”. 需要说明的是:我希望能够编辑我的用户而不必覆盖他们的密码,但是cakePHP验证程序工具不允许我做我想做的事… 我已经看过CakePHP: Edit Users without changing password和Updating user email and password with CakePHP了,但看起来确实很脏: >第一个不将规则应用于onUpdate>第二个显示哈希(只是不… u_u“) 还有别的办法吗? (行越少越好)解决方法:TL; DR: ...

重写规则不适用于IIS上的CakePHP【代码】

我一直在尝试使用以下根目录中的web.config设置来使重写规则在IIS for CakePHP上运行:<?xml version="1.0" encoding="UTF-8"?> <configuration><system.webServer><rewrite><rules><rule name="Imported Rule 1" stopProcessing="true"><match url="^$" ignoreCase="false" /><action type="Rewrite" url="app/webroot/" /></rule><rule name="Imported Rule 2" stopProcessing="true"><match url="(.*)" ignoreCase="false" /><a...

CakePHP 3.0.8转换行为和数据验证(requirePresence,notEmpty)【代码】

我的问题很简单,但我不知道如何解决. 我的网站是多语言的.我希望用户能够根据需要添加多种语言的文章,同时要求输入语言(取决于语言环境). 问题是,根据CakePHP的翻译约定,无论使用哪种语言,所有输入都必须以字段名称结尾.因此,所有字段对于同一字段都具有相同的规则.我不能要求一个“名称”,而不需要另一种语言的名称. 例如,默认语言的输入为:<input type="text" name="name" required="required" maxlength="45" id="name">然后,在...

错误 - 相关标签